Funding Secured to Advance Design of Carnegie’s MoorPower Commercial Pilot
2025-06-29 16:30
Favorite

Wedoany.com Report-Jun 29, Carnegie Clean Energy, an Australian wave energy developer, has received AUD 335,020 (approximately $218,000) from the Blue Economy Cooperative Research Centre (Blue Economy CRC) to fund preliminary design work for the first commercial pilot of its MoorPower wave energy system in 2025. This initiative builds on the success of the 2024 MoorPower Scaled Demonstrator project, aiming to integrate the technology with aquaculture feeding barges.

The project, conducted in collaboration with Huon Aquaculture, Advanced Composite Structures Australia, the University of Tasmania, and specialist subcontractors, focuses on adapting MoorPower for offshore aquaculture operations. The design phase will address key operational aspects, including mooring configurations, barge movement, and regulatory compliance, to support future investment in a full-scale deployment. “This project follows the successful completion of the MoorPower Scaled Demonstrator Project in 2024 and aims to deliver the required detail to unlock investment in a Commercial Pilot Project, which would be the first commercial application of the MoorPower technology in the aquaculture industry,” a Carnegie spokesperson stated.

MoorPower, a surface-based wave converter system, leverages the same principles as Carnegie’s CETO power take-off technology but at a smaller scale, allowing knowledge transfer to projects like CETO Wave Energy Ireland’s ACHIEVE program in Europe, which received €137,152 in May 2025. Designed for offshore energy needs, MoorPower targets aquaculture barges and vessels, offering detachable modules for easy maintenance in remote locations.

The Blue Economy CRC provides full cash funding, with partners contributing an additional AUD 417,000 in in-kind support. Carnegie and the CRC are also working to secure backing for the construction and operation of the first full-scale system, advancing the technology toward commercial use. The project aims to deliver sustainable energy solutions for aquaculture, reducing reliance on traditional power sources in offshore environments.

By refining MoorPower for practical integration, Carnegie is positioning Australia as a leader in wave energy innovation. The collaboration with industry and academic partners ensures the system meets operational and environmental standards, paving the way for scalable, clean energy solutions in the aquaculture sector.
